Description

Medical waste treatment reducing mechanism
Technical Field
The utility model relates to a clinical medical treatment technical field specifically is a medical waste handles reducing mechanism.
Background
Along with the continuous improvement of medical treatment level, each medical personnel also is improving continuously to the protection requirement of self, and common virus mainly propagates and contacts the propagation through the droplet, therefore medical supplies such as gauze mask become effectual protection tool, can realize carrying out effectual isolation to the virus in the air through the gauze mask.
However, there are some problems in the process of intensively cleaning the waste medical materials used in clinical medical treatment, for example, some manufacturers recover the used waste medical materials for cost saving, then subject the waste medical materials to treatments such as sterilization and the like to continue selling, and cannot reach the due protection standard, and when the used waste medical materials are discarded in the open air, viruses at the upper end contact with the air, so that the possibility of infection is increased.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-5, the present invention provides a technical solution: a medical waste treatment crushing device comprises a collecting box shell 1, a base 2, a cover plate 3, a bearing plate 4, a pulling rope 5, a fixed pulley 6, a first rotating shaft 7, a connecting plate 8, a pedal 9, a movable sliding block 10, a motor 11, a second rotating shaft 12, a cutting knife 13, a driving wheel 14, a driven wheel 15, a supporting device 16, a limiting ball 1601, a positioning rod 1602, a sealing cover 17 and a heating device 18, wherein the base 2 is installed on the collecting box shell 1, the collecting box shell 1 and the cover plate 3 are mutually attached, the bearing plate 4 is installed on the cover plate 3, the bearing plate 4 and the collecting box shell 1 are mutually attached, the pulling rope 5 is installed on the bearing plate 4, the pulling rope 5 and the fixed pulley 6 are mutually attached, the fixed pulley 6 is installed on the first rotating shaft 7, the first rotating shaft 7 and the collecting box shell 1 are mutually connected, the connecting plate 8 and the pulling rope 5 are, and install footboard 9 on the connecting plate 8, and install the removal slider 10 on the connecting plate 8, remove slider 10 and the mutual laminating of collecting box shell 1 simultaneously, motor 11 places on collecting box shell 1, and install second axis of rotation 12 on the motor 11, and the welding has cutting knife 13 on the second axis of rotation 12, second axis of rotation 12 and collecting box shell 1 interconnect simultaneously, action wheel 14 is installed on second axis of rotation 12, and install from driving wheel 15 on the second axis of rotation 12, and from driving wheel 15 and action wheel 14 interconnect, install strutting arrangement 16 on the second axis of rotation 12 simultaneously, strutting arrangement 16 installs on collecting box shell 1, and the laminating has sealed lid 17 on the collecting box shell 1, and install heating device 18 on the collecting box shell 1.
In the embodiment, the bearing plate 4 is L-shaped, the bearing plate 4 is in sliding connection with the collecting box shell 1 through a groove formed in the collecting box shell 1, the bearing plate 4 is L-shaped, so that the pulling rope 5 can be conveniently installed at the upper end of the bearing plate, the bearing plate 4 is in sliding connection with the collecting box shell 1 through a groove formed in the collecting box shell 1, and the bearing plate 4 can freely slide in the groove;
a U-shaped groove is formed in the fixed pulley 6, the fixed pulley 6 and the collecting box shell 1 form a rotating mechanism through the first rotating shaft 7, the U-shaped groove is formed in the fixed pulley 6, the left end and the right end of the pulling rope 5 are conveniently limited, and the rotation of the fixed pulley 6 is not influenced while the fixed pulley 6 is supported;
the second rotating shaft 12 is symmetrically distributed about the center of the second rotating shaft 12, and the cutting knives 13 are alternately distributed on the second rotating shaft 12, so that the waste medical objects can be conveniently cut up through the rotation of the second rotating shaft 12, and the cutting knives 13 are alternately distributed on the second rotating shaft 12, so that the waste medical objects can be more thoroughly cut;
the supporting device 16 comprises a limiting ball 1601 and a positioning rod 1602, the limiting ball 1601 is attached to the supporting device 16, the limiting ball 1601 is attached to the positioning rod 1602, the positioning rod 1602 is attached to the supporting device 16, and the positioning rod 1602 is mounted on the second rotating shaft 12, so that the second rotating shaft 12 can be fixed in an auxiliary manner, and the position of the second rotating shaft 12 is prevented from being changed in the using process;
limiting ball 1601 constitutes sliding connection through the arc recess of seting up on locating lever 1602 with locating lever 1602, and locating lever 1602 sets up to the smooth square cubic in surface, is convenient for reduce the frictional force between locating lever 1602 and the strutting arrangement 16 when second axis of rotation 12 rotates, and locating lever 1602 sets up to the smooth square cubic in surface, is convenient for support second axis of rotation 12.
The working principle is as follows: when the used waste medical materials need to be discarded, the pedal 9 in the drawing 1 is stepped, the pedal 9 starts to move downwards under the limiting action of the connecting plate 8, the pulling rope 5 is installed on the pedal 9, the fixed pulley 6 starts to rotate clockwise along with the downward movement of the connecting plate 8, the bearing plate 4 starts to move upwards because the pulling rope 5 is installed on the bearing plate 4, the bearing plate 4 and the cover plate 3 are connected with each other, and the bearing plate 4 and the collecting box shell 1 form sliding connection through a groove formed in the collecting box shell 1, so that the cover plate 3 starts to move upwards, and the discarded waste medical materials can be discarded into the collecting box shell 1;
when the waste medical materials are needed to be disinfected and cut, the motor 11 in fig. 1 is connected with an external power supply, the motor 11 starts to work, because the output end of the motor 11 is connected with the second rotating shaft 12, the second rotating shaft 12 starts to rotate clockwise, namely, the driving wheel 14 also rotates clockwise, because the cutting knife 13 arranged on the second rotating shaft 12, the cutting knife 13 at the left end starts to rotate clockwise, because the driving wheel 14 is meshed and connected with the driven wheel 15, the driven wheel 15 starts to rotate anticlockwise, so the second rotating shaft 12 arranged on the driven wheel 15 also rotates anticlockwise, the cutting knife 13 arranged on the second rotating shaft 12 at the right end starts to rotate anticlockwise, at this time, the waste medical materials are cut, the heating device 18 starts to work, the heating device 18 kills the viruses in the collecting box shell 1 through high temperature, when the cleaning is completed, the sealing cover 17 is opened, so that the discarded medical supplies, which are shredded, in the collecting container housing 1 are taken out.
